Essential Skills for Tech-Driven Learning

The heart of the Advanced Certificate in Tech-Driven Learning lies in developing a robust set of skills that educators need to effectively integrate technology in their classrooms. These skills are not just about knowing how to use software and devices but also understanding how technology can be leveraged to foster deeper learning and engagement.

# 1. Digital Pedagogy

Digital pedagogy involves the strategic use of technology to support student learning. Key aspects include:

- Blended Learning: Combining traditional classroom instruction with online learning.

- Flipped Classroom: Reversing the traditional lecture-homework model.

- Interactive Learning Tools: Utilizing apps, games, and multimedia resources to make learning more engaging.

# 2. Data Literacy

Educators need to be adept at using data to inform their teaching practices. This includes:

- Analyzing Learning Analytics: Understanding how student data can be used to improve educational outcomes.

- Grading and Assessment Tools: Using digital tools for more efficient and effective assessment.

- Privacy and Ethical Use: Ensuring that data collected from students is handled responsibly and ethically.

# 3. Content Creation

Creating engaging and interactive content is crucial in a tech-driven learning environment. Skills in:

- Video Production: Using tools like Camtasia or Loom to create educational videos.

- Interactive Content: Developing interactive quizzes and simulations.

- Web Design: Creating engaging and user-friendly websites and learning platforms.

Best Practices for Tech-Driven Learning

Implementing technology in education requires more than just knowing how to use tools. Best practices ensure that technology is integrated in a way that enhances learning outcomes. Here are some key strategies:

# 1. Student-Centered Approach

Focus on what students need and how technology can support their learning. This includes:

- Personalized Learning Paths: Using technology to tailor learning experiences to individual student needs.

- Collaborative Tools: Encouraging group projects and peer learning through tools like Google Classroom or Microsoft Teams.

- Feedback Mechanisms: Implementing tools that provide immediate feedback to students, helping them understand their progress and areas for improvement.

# 2. Professional Development

Continuous learning is essential for educators to stay updated with the latest technologies and best practices. This includes:

- Workshops and Conferences: Participating in professional development events to learn from experts.

- Online Resources: Utilizing online courses and tutorials to enhance skills.

- Peer Collaboration: Working with other educators to share ideas and strategies.

# 3. Infrastructure and Support

Having the right infrastructure and support is crucial for successful tech integration. This includes:

- Device Management: Ensuring that devices are accessible and well-maintained.

- Technical Support: Having access to IT support to troubleshoot issues.

- Cybersecurity Measures: Implementing robust cybersecurity protocols to protect student data.

Career Opportunities in Tech-Driven Learning

The demand for educators with advanced skills in tech-driven learning is on the rise. Graduates of the Advanced Certificate in Tech-Driven Learning can explore a variety of career paths:

# 1. Instructional Technologist

Working in educational technology companies, these professionals help design and implement technology solutions for schools and universities.

# 2. Learning Designer

Specializing in creating engaging and effective learning experiences, often for online platforms.
